Patna, April 30 -- Janata Dal (United) Bihar unit president Umesh Singh Kushwaha on Thursday launched a sharp attack on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D) leader Tejaswi Yadav, accusing him of making baseless allegations to salvage his "sinking political credibility."Kushwaha claimed that the RJD's political base is steadily shrinking and the party has lost its credibility among the people. He alleged that Tejaswi Yadav is making "irrational" statements out of political frustration.
